Where does “yhdessäolo” come from?

yhdessäolo (Finnish) comes from Finnish olo, from Finnish olla, from Proto-Finnic oldak, from Proto-Uralic wole- — to be, become; be, will be.

yhdessäolo (Finnish): being together, association

Definitions

  1. being together, association
